A report by Al Jazeera, on 15 November 2023 mentioned that as per sources, H.H. Sheikha Moza bint Nasser has withdrawn from her position as a goodwill ambassador with the United Nations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O). She has worked with the UN to support education since 2003.
The report mentioned that sources told Al Jazeera that the move came after H.H. Sheikha Moza said UNESCO had failed to carry out its role in rescuing and providing relief to the children of Gaza, who are the primary victims of Israel's ongoing bombardment campaign.
As per the sources, H.H. Sheikha Moza announced her decision during a summit in Istanbul on 15 November 2023.
